What is Cabochon Natural Turquoise?

Cabochon natural turquoise refers to turquoise that has been cut and polished into a smooth, rounded shape without facets, retaining its natural beauty. This method of cutting showcases the stone's rich color and intricate matrix patterns, making it a popular choice for both artisan and commercial jewelry designs.

The Rich History of Turquoise

Turquoise has a deep-rooted history, revered by many ancient civilizations, including the Egyptians, Persians, and Native Americans. They valued turquoise not just for its stunning appearance but also for its believed protective and healing properties. Today, cabochon natural turquoise continues to be a symbol of wisdom, tranquility, and protection.

The Unique Features of Cabochon Turquoise

One of the key attractions of cabochon turquoise is its vibrant color. The gemstone ranges from sky blues to rich greenish shades, often embellished with intricate veining or matrix. Each cabochon is unique, making it a coveted choice for handmade jewelry. Here are some essential features you should know:

Color Variations

Cabochon turquoise can exhibit a spectrum of colors due to varying amounts of copper and iron content in the stone. The most sought-after shades are intense blue or green, often tied to specific mining locations, such as:

  • Sleeping Beauty Turquoise: A pure sky blue variety from Arizona.
  • Kingman Turquoise: Known for its earthy shades with matrix variations.
  • Dominican Turquoise: A rare gemstone featuring a striking blue-green hue.

Durability and Care

Despite its beauty, turquoise is relatively soft, with a Mohs hardness of 5 to 6. This means that cabochon turquoise should be cared for with caution to avoid scratches and damage. Here are some essential care tips:

  • Keep turmeric away from direct sunlight and heat.
  • Clean gently with a soft, damp cloth, avoiding harsh chemicals.
  • Store separately to prevent scratching against harder gemstones.
